制定一个成功的IT职业规划需要从自我评估、行业趋势、技能学习、实践经验、职业网络和持续学习六个方面入手。本文将通过具体案例和可操作建议,帮助你明确职业方向,掌握关键技能,构建职业网络,并实现长期发展。
一、自我评估与兴趣探索
-
明确个人兴趣与优势
在IT领域,职业选择多样,从开发、运维到数据科学、网络安全等。首先,你需要通过自我评估工具(如MBTI、霍兰德职业兴趣测试)或反思过往项目经验,明确自己的兴趣点和优势。例如,如果你对逻辑思维和编程充满热情,开发岗位可能更适合你;如果你擅长沟通和协调,IT项目管理可能是更好的选择。 -
设定短期与长期目标
根据兴趣和优势,设定清晰的职业目标。短期目标可以是掌握某项技术(如Python编程),长期目标可以是成为某一领域的专家(如人工智能工程师)。目标设定要具体、可衡量,并定期调整。
二、行业趋势分析
-
关注技术发展趋势
IT行业变化迅速,新技术层出不穷。你需要关注行业报告(如Gartner技术成熟度曲线)和权威媒体(如TechCrunch、InfoQ),了解当前热门技术(如云计算、区块链、AI)和未来趋势(如量子计算、边缘计算)。 -
分析市场需求与竞争
通过招聘网站(如LinkedIn、Indeed)和行业论坛,分析目标岗位的技能需求和竞争情况。例如,数据科学家岗位可能要求掌握Python、SQL和机器学习算法,而网络安全岗位则更注重CISSP、CEH等认证。
三、技能学习路径规划
-
选择适合的学习资源
根据目标岗位的技能需求,选择合适的学习资源。例如,Coursera、Udemy等在线平台提供丰富的IT课程,GitHub和Stack Overflow是学习编程和解决问题的好去处。 -
制定学习计划并坚持执行
将学习目标分解为阶段性任务,并制定详细的学习计划。例如,每周学习10小时,完成一个在线课程或项目。通过定期复盘和调整计划,确保学习效果。
四、实践经验积累策略
-
参与开源项目或实习
实践是掌握技能的挺好方式。你可以通过GitHub参与开源项目,或在公司实习积累实际经验。例如,参与一个Python开源项目,不仅能提升编程能力,还能展示你的贡献。 -
构建个人项目集
通过个人项目(如开发一个小型应用或数据分析报告),展示你的技能和创造力。这些项目可以作为简历的亮点,帮助你在求职中脱颖而出。
五、职业网络构建方法
-
参加行业会议与社区活动
通过参加技术会议(如AWS re:Invent、Google I/O)和本地技术社区活动,结识行业专家和同行。这些活动不仅能拓宽视野,还能为职业发展提供机会。 -
利用社交媒体与专业平台
在LinkedIn、Twitter等平台分享你的学习心得和项目经验,与行业专家互动。通过建立个人品牌,提升职业影响力。
六、持续学习与发展计划
-
定期更新知识与技能
IT行业技术更新快,持续学习是职业发展的关键。你可以通过订阅技术博客、参加在线课程或考取认证(如AWS认证、PMP认证),保持竞争力。 -
寻求导师与反馈
找到一位经验丰富的导师,定期交流职业发展中的困惑和挑战。通过导师的反馈和建议,调整职业规划,实现更快成长。
制定一个成功的IT职业规划需要从自我评估、行业趋势、技能学习、实践经验、职业网络和持续学习六个方面入手。通过明确目标、掌握关键技能、积累实践经验、构建职业网络并保持持续学习,你可以在快速变化的IT行业中实现长期发展。记住,职业规划是一个动态过程,需要根据个人兴趣和行业变化不断调整。
原创文章,作者:IT_admin,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/217786